Foros del Web » Programando para Internet » PHP »

permisos de ficheros en php

Estas en el tema de permisos de ficheros en php en el foro de PHP en Foros del Web. cuando trato de cambiar los permisos de un fichero a travez de php , no me lo permite, osea primero veo que permisos tiene, me ...
  #1 (permalink)  
Antiguo 01/02/2002, 15:34
 
Fecha de Ingreso: diciembre-2001
Mensajes: 451
Antigüedad: 16 años
Puntos: 0
permisos de ficheros en php

cuando trato de cambiar los permisos de un fichero a travez de php , no me lo permite, osea primero veo que permisos tiene, me muestra que tiene 744 ,
y luego trato de cambiarlos con chmod($fichero,0766), okay, logicamente esto estaria bien, ahora , porke no me deja cambiarlos?...
hago el script y luego lo ejecuto en el navegador, yo digo que al meterse a travez del navegador accede con los permisos publicos (osea 4) y no con los permisos con los que he logeado al servidor para editar los archivos. Por lo cual, el permiso para publico deberia ser 7 ya que con 7 tiene todos los privilegios cierto?

alguien me puede hechar una manito con eso, por favor?
  #2 (permalink)  
Antiguo 01/02/2002, 18:25
Avatar de chubu  
Fecha de Ingreso: enero-2002
Ubicación: Buenos Aires
Mensajes: 133
Antigüedad: 15 años, 10 meses
Puntos: 0
Re: permisos de ficheros en php

efectivamente
el web server corre como un usuario determinado, que seguramente no es ni tu usuario de login, ni esta en tu grupo, asi que usa el tercer permiso, el de Others, que esta en 4, por lo que no puede escribir sobre el archivo, y por ende no puede cambiar permisos, tendrias que cambiarlo a 6 a mano (6 es mejor que 7, ya que le podes escribir y leer pero no ejecutar, un tema de seguridad nomas).

saludos

  #3 (permalink)  
Antiguo 04/02/2002, 10:00
 
Fecha de Ingreso: diciembre-2001
Mensajes: 451
Antigüedad: 16 años
Puntos: 0
Re: permisos de ficheros en php

okas, me sacaste de la duda, y gracias, ahora otra mas , si por ejemplo yo tengo un script que CREA un archivo, o digamos que sube un archivo, este archivo nuevo , puede ser alterado en sus permisos como en mi pregunta anterior?...ya que el archivo seria creado por un usuario perteneciente al OTROS... yo se que no es conveniente ni se ajusta a mis concepciones de la seguridad del sistema, pero ya sabes como son los jefes...
  #4 (permalink)  
Antiguo 04/02/2002, 11:34
 
Fecha de Ingreso: diciembre-2001
Mensajes: 451
Antigüedad: 16 años
Puntos: 0
Re: permisos de ficheros en php

plis help!!!...he intentado varias veces pero no me funka, no se si me explique bien lo que quiero hacer...
  #5 (permalink)  
Antiguo 04/02/2002, 13:28
Avatar de chubu  
Fecha de Ingreso: enero-2002
Ubicación: Buenos Aires
Mensajes: 133
Antigüedad: 15 años, 10 meses
Puntos: 0
Re: permisos de ficheros en php

si el archivo es creado o subido por el php, pertenece al usuario con el que corre el webserver (usualmente nobody, o apache), y desde el php lo puedes cambiar a tu gusto, porque lo haces como ese usuario, ya que el php lo ejecuta el webserver.

saludos

  #6 (permalink)  
Antiguo 04/02/2002, 13:54
 
Fecha de Ingreso: diciembre-2001
Mensajes: 451
Antigüedad: 16 años
Puntos: 0
Re: permisos de ficheros en php

vale chubu, es lo que necesitaba, no se como no lo deduci antes, que ***** soy...jejejeje ;)

gracias....
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:27.